Animal Feed & Fish Feed Packaging: Bulk & Retail Options

The Malaysian livestock and aquaculture industries have grown significantly, driven by rising domestic demand for poultry, fish, and dairy products. With this growth comes the need for packaging that preserves feed freshness, prevents contamination, and withstands the rigours of storage and logistics.

Bulk Animal Feed Packaging

For large-scale feed mill operations, bulk packaging is the most cost-efficient solution. Animal feed packaging typically uses woven polypropylene (PP) bags laminated with a polyethylene (PE) inner layer. These bags offer excellent tensile strength, moisture resistance, and puncture resistance—essential qualities when transporting tonnes of feed across long distances.

Standard configurations include:

  • 50 kg woven PP/PE laminated bags — the industry standard for poultry, swine, and cattle feed
  • 1-tonne FIBC (Flexible Intermediate Bulk Containers) — ideal for bulk storage and containerised shipping
  • Ventilated woven bags — designed for feeds with higher moisture content to prevent mould growth

Many feed mills in Malaysia are also shifting toward multi-walled kraft paper bags with a PE barrier for better breathability and eco-friendliness. Retail & Small-Format Animal Feed Packaging

For the growing pet food and small-livestock market, retail-ready packaging formats are essential. Small-format animal feed packaging options include:

  • Stand-up pouches with zip-lock resealability — popular for premium dog, cat, and bird food
  • Side-gusseted flat pouches — budget-friendly for smaller feed quantities (1 kg to 10 kg)
  • Doctored rollstock — for heat-sealed bagging machines in automated packing lines

Retail feed bags often feature high-quality flexographic or rotogravure printing to communicate nutritional information, brand identity, and feeding instructions clearly.

Fish Feed Packaging

Malaysia is one of the largest aquaculture producers in Southeast Asia, and fish feed packaging has unique requirements compared to land-animal feed. Fish feed is typically high in oil content, making it prone to oxidation and rancidity if exposed to oxygen and light.

For this reason, fish feed packaging commonly uses:

  • Aluminium foil laminated pouches — provide an exceptional oxygen and light barrier
  • Vacuum-sealed bags — extend shelf life by removing oxygen from the package
  • Multi-layer co-extruded films — combine strength with high-barrier properties without the cost of foil

The ideal fish feed packaging solution also maintains structural integrity when exposed to moisture in cold storage or high-humidity environments common in Malaysian fish farms.

Pesticide & Fertilizer Pouch Packaging: Safety First

Industrial retail plastic bag for agricultural packaging

Agricultural chemicals demand packaging that prioritises safety, durability, and regulatory compliance. Whether you are packaging liquid pesticides, granular herbicides, or powdered fertilisers, the wrong bag can lead to product degradation, environmental contamination, or health hazards for handlers.

Pesticide Packaging

Pesticide packaging in Malaysia is governed by stringent regulations under the Pesticides Act 1974 and guidelines from the Department of Agriculture. Packaging must prevent leakage, resist chemical corrosion, and include clear hazard labelling in both Bahasa Malaysia and English.

Common formats for pesticide packaging include:

  • Co-extruded multi-layer pouches — resistant to solvent-based and water-based pesticide formulations
  • Aluminium foil sachets and stick packs — single-use packaging that prevents overdosing and cross-contamination
  • HDPE bottles with child-resistant closures — for liquid pesticide concentrates

For granular and powder pesticides, laminated heavy duty plastic bags with heat-sealed seams provide excellent protection against moisture ingress and accidental spillage.

Fertilizer Pouch Solutions

Fertilisers are among the most challenging products to package. They are often hygroscopic (moisture-absorbing), abrasive, and chemically reactive. A well-designed fertilizer pouch must therefore offer:

  • High moisture barrier — typically achieved with a PE/PP laminate or BOPP/metallised film
  • Abrasion resistance — woven PP or heavy-gauge PE to withstand sharp granular particles
  • UV protection — for bags stored outdoors in plantation environments
  • Heat-sealed closure — to prevent moisture ingress and caking

For retail fertiliser, stand-up pouches with handle cut-outs are increasingly popular. They are shelf-appealing, easy to carry, and can be printed with application instructions and safety warnings. For bulk fertiliser, 50 kg woven PP bags with PE liners remain the standard choice across Malaysian estates and agricultural cooperatives.

Seed & Veterinary Packaging Pouches

High-value agricultural inputs like seeds and veterinary products require packaging that preserves viability, prevents contamination, and extends shelf life. These products are often sensitive to moisture, temperature, and physical damage.

Seed Packaging Pouches

Seeds are living organisms that must remain viable until planting. A high-quality seed packaging pouch must regulate moisture and gas exchange to maintain germination rates. Key packaging specifications include:

  • Moisture barrier film — to maintain low humidity inside the package
  • Micro-perforated options — allow controlled gas exchange for certain seed varieties
  • Light-blocking layers — protect light-sensitive seeds from UV degradation
  • Reclosable features — allow farmers to use seeds incrementally without compromising the remaining stock

Packaging formats range from small foil sachets (for hybrid seeds sold in packs of 10–100 seeds) to multi-walled paper bags with PE liners (for bulk cereal and vegetable seeds in 5 kg to 25 kg quantities).

Veterinary Packaging

Veterinary packaging encompasses a wide range of products—from oral medications and vaccines to topical treatments and injectables. Each product category requires specific packaging features:

  • Blister packs and strip packs — for tablets, capsules, and boluses; provides individual dose protection
  • Laminated foil pouches — for powders, granules, and water-soluble medications
  • Multi-layer film rollstock — for automated veterinary feed medication packaging
  • Child-resistant and tamper-evident features — increasingly mandated for veterinary pharmaceuticals

As the Malaysian veterinary pharmaceutical market grows, manufacturers are demanding packaging that not only protects the product but also complies with the National Pharmaceutical Regulatory Agency (NPRA) guidelines and Good Manufacturing Practices (GMP).

Heavy Duty Plastic Bags for Industrial Use

Custom shopping bag for industrial and bulk packaging

When standard packaging cannot handle the load, heavy duty plastic bags step in. These bags are engineered to transport, store, and protect industrial materials ranging from construction aggregates and chemical powders to recyclable waste and industrial components.

What Makes a Bag “Heavy Duty”?

The term “heavy duty” refers to the bag’s thickness (gauge), tensile strength, and puncture resistance. In Malaysia, heavy duty plastic bags typically use:

  • Low-Density Polyethylene (LDPE) — flexible and tear-resistant; ideal for general industrial waste and light chemicals
  • High-Density Polyethylene (HDPE) — rigid and strong; suitable for sharp or abrasive contents
  • Linear Low-Density Polyethylene (LLDPE) — excellent puncture and stretch resistance; preferred for heavy or irregular loads
  • Woven Polypropylene (WPP) — extremely high tensile strength; used for construction materials, sand, and fertilisers

Common Industrial Applications

Application Recommended Bag Type Typical Thickness
Construction debris Woven PP or HDPE 80-200 microns
Chemical powders LDPE/LLDPE with liners 60-150 microns
Recyclable waste HDPE or LDPE 50-100 microns
Metal components Anti-static LDPE 75-200 microns
Rubber granules Woven PP 100-200 microns

Customisation Options

Leading Malaysian packaging suppliers offer extensive customisation for heavy duty plastic bags, including:

  • Custom dimensions — tailored to your product size and pallet configuration
  • Colour-coded bags — for inventory management and waste segregation
  • Printed branding and warnings — high-quality flexographic or gravure printing
  • Seal options — flat heat seal, gusseted bottom, star seal, or pinch-bottom
  • Handle and tie options — drawstrings, die-cut handles, or press-to-close seals

UV Protection Bags for Outdoor Storage

Malaysia’s tropical climate poses a significant challenge for outdoor storage. With UV indices frequently reaching extreme levels between 10 AM and 3 PM, standard plastic bags can degrade within weeks of sun exposure. This is where uv protection bag solutions become critical.

How UV Protection Works

UV stabilisers are additives incorporated into the plastic resin during the extrusion or blown film process. These additives absorb or block ultraviolet radiation, preventing the polymer chains from breaking down (photodegradation). The level of UV protection is measured by the bag’s ability to retain tensile strength and elongation after exposure to UV light.

For outdoor storage applications in Malaysia, look for:

  • UV-stabilised woven PP bags — ideal for construction materials, fertilisers, and agricultural produce stored in open areas
  • UV-resistant PE tarpaulins and covers — for covering pallets and equipment
  • Carbon black additive — one of the most effective and cost-efficient UV stabilisers; gives bags their characteristic dark colour

Applications for UV Protection Bags

A uv protection bag is essential whenever products are stored outdoors for more than a few days. Common Malaysian applications include:

  • Plantation and estate storage — fertilisers, herbicides, and seeds stored in open sheds
  • Construction sites — sand, cement, and aggregates left uncovered
  • Logistics yards — goods awaiting container loading or cross-docking
  • Agricultural waste collection — empty pesticide containers and plantation waste

For maximum durability, combine UV-stabilised bags with opaque or reflective outer layers. This dual-layer approach significantly extends bag lifespan in direct sunlight.

Anti-Static & Conductive Bags for Electronics

Custom slider top bag for industrial specialty packaging

Malaysia is a global hub for electronics manufacturing, particularly in Penang, Selangor, and Johor. The semiconductor and electronics industries require specialised packaging to protect sensitive components from electrostatic discharge (ESD). Even a minor static discharge can destroy microchips, circuit boards, and other electronic components.

Anti-Static vs. Conductive vs. Static-Shielding

Understanding the difference between these categories is crucial when selecting the right anti static bag malaysia solution:

Anti-Static (Pink/Blue Bags):

  • Made from polyethylene with anti-static additives
  • Prevents static charge generation on the bag surface
  • Dissipates existing charge at a controlled rate
  • Suitable for non-sensitive components and low-risk environments

Conductive Plastic Bag:

  • Contains carbon or metallic fillers throughout the material
  • Provides a low-resistance path for charge dissipation
  • Used for highly sensitive components (MOSFETs, ICs, laser diodes)
  • Surface resistivity typically below 10^5 ohms per square

Static-Shielding Bags (Metal-In):

  • Multi-layer construction with a metallised film layer
  • Provides Faraday cage protection
  • Blocks both generated and external electrostatic fields
  • Required for shipping sensitive electronics across Malaysia and internationally

Choosing the Right ESD Bag

When selecting a conductive plastic bag or anti-static solution, consider:

1. Component sensitivity — use static-shielding for Class 0 (<250V HBM) devices

2. Storage vs. shipping — anti-static may suffice for storage; shielded bags are essential for shipping

3. Reusability — conductive and anti-static bags can be reused; shielding bags are typically single-use

4. Custom sizes — printed ESD bags with logos and traceability codes are available from Malaysian suppliers

Malaysian Compliance Standards

Electronic packaging in Malaysia should meet international ESD standards:

  • ANSI/ESD S20.20 — programme requirements for ESD control
  • IEC 61340-5-1 — protection of electronic devices against electrostatic phenomena
  • MIL-PRF-81705 — military-grade static shielding requirements

Reputable anti static bag malaysia suppliers will provide test reports and compliance certificates for their products.

Child Resistant & Child Proof Packaging

Child safety is a growing regulatory concern in Malaysia, particularly for household chemicals, pesticides, and veterinary and pharmaceutical products. Child proof bag and child resistant packaging solutions are now mandated under several regulatory frameworks, including the Pesticides Act 1974 and Poison Act 1952.

How Child-Resistant Packaging Works

Child-resistant (CR) packaging is designed to be difficult for children under five years of age to open while remaining accessible to adults. CR packaging is not the same as “child-proof” — no packaging is 100% child-proof — but certified CR packaging significantly reduces the risk of accidental ingestion or exposure.

Common child resistant packaging formats include:

  • Press-and-turn bottle caps — standard for liquid chemicals and medications
  • Push-down-and-twist closures — for pouches and sachets
  • Slide-lock and zipper-lock with CR mechanism — for resealable pouches
  • Peel-push blister packs — used for tablets and capsules
  • Single-dose sachets with tear-notch design — requires a specific sequence to open

Child Proof Bag Options

For flexible packaging applications, child proof bag solutions have evolved significantly. Modern designs include:

  • Sliding-lock zipper with child-resistant latch — requires a specific two-step action to open
  • Double-layer seal sachets — outer layer opens to reveal a second sealed compartment
  • Adhesive seal with pull-tab — requires dexterity and strength beyond a child’s capability

These bags are widely used in Malaysia for:

  • Garden and household pesticide refills
  • Veterinary medications and supplements
  • Laundry detergent pods and liquid refills
  • Industrial cleaning chemicals sold in retail quantities

Certification Requirements

For a child proof bag to be compliant, it must pass standardised testing protocols:

  • ISO 8317 — child-resistant packaging requirements and testing
  • BS EN 14375 — child-resistant non-reclosable packaging
  • US 16 CFR 1700 — US Poison Prevention Packaging Act (often referenced globally)

Malaysian manufacturers should request certification documentation from their packaging suppliers to ensure compliance with both local and export market requirements.

Material & Certification Requirements

Selecting the right packaging material is only half the battle. Ensuring that your packaging meets Malaysian regulatory and industry standards is equally important. Below are the key material types and certifications relevant to industrial, agricultural, and specialty bags.

Common Material Types

Material Key Properties Typical Applications
Woven Polypropylene (WPP) High tensile strength, UV-stabilised Bulk feed, fertiliser, construction
Polyethylene (LDPE/HDPE/LLDPE) Flexible, moisture-resistant Heavy duty bags, liners, general industrial
Biaxially Oriented Polypropylene (BOPP) High clarity, printability Retail pouches, seed packs
Aluminium Foil Laminate Excellent barrier (O2, light, moisture) Fish feed, pesticides, veterinary
Multi-layer Co-extruded Film Tunable barrier properties Chemical, pharmaceutical, food-grade
Conductive/Anti-static PE ESD protection Electronics, sensitive components

Key Malaysian Certifications

SIRIM Certification

SIRIM is Malaysia’s national standards body. For packaging products, SIRIM certification ensures compliance with Malaysian Standards (MS) for quality, safety, and performance.

MESTI (Good Manufacturing Practice) Certification

Required for food-grade and animal feed packaging. Suppliers must maintain hygienic manufacturing environments and documented quality control procedures.

ISO 9001:2015

Quality management system certification. Indicates that the manufacturer follows internationally recognised quality control processes.

FDA & EU Equivalent Standards

For packaging exported to the US or European markets, suppliers should provide compliance with FDA 21 CFR and EU Regulation 1935/2004 for food-contact materials.

RoHS & REACH Compliance

For electronics packaging, ensure that anti static bag malaysia products meet RoHS (Restriction of Hazardous Substances) and REACH (Registration, Evaluation, Authorisation of Restriction of Chemicals) standards.

FAQ — Industrial, Agricultural & Specialty Bags

Q1: What is the difference between HDPE and LDPE heavy duty plastic bags?

A: HDPE (High-Density Polyethylene) is more rigid and offers better puncture resistance, making it ideal for sharp or abrasive contents like construction debris. LDPE (Low-Density Polyethylene) is more flexible and tear-resistant, better suited for general industrial waste and chemical powders. LLDPE offers a balance of both properties with excellent stretch resistance.

Q2: Can animal feed packaging be recycled?

A: Yes, most animal feed packaging made from woven PP or PE can be recycled. However, multi-laminated structures (foil or metallised layers) are more challenging. Many Malaysian recyclers accept clean PP and PE feed bags. Check with your local recycling facility for specific acceptance criteria.

Q3: What certification do I need for pesticide packaging in Malaysia?

A: Pesticide packaging in Malaysia must comply with the Pesticides Act 1974 and guidelines from the Department of Agriculture. Key requirements include child-resistant closures for liquid pesticides, hazard labelling in dual languages, and leakage-proof construction. SIRIM certification and MS compliance are highly recommended.

Q4: Are anti static bags required for all electronic components?

A: Not all components require anti static bag malaysia protection. Non-sensitive components like resistors, connectors, and basic PCBs can be stored in standard PE bags. However, semiconductor devices, integrated circuits, MOSFETs, and laser diodes require at minimum anti-static or static-shielding bags to prevent electrostatic discharge damage.

Q5: How long do UV protection bags last outdoors in Malaysia?

A: A high-quality uv protection bag with proper UV stabilisers can last 6–12 months of continuous outdoor exposure in Malaysia’s tropical climate. Bags with carbon black additive tend to offer the longest lifespan. Without UV protection, standard PE bags may degrade within 4–8 weeks.

Q6: What is the minimum order quantity for custom-printed heavy duty plastic bags?

A: Minimum order quantities vary widely depending on the bag type and printing complexity. For standard woven PP bags with one-colour printing, MOQs typically start at 5,000–10,000 pieces. For laminated pouches with multi-colour gravure printing, MOQs can range from 10,000–50,000 pieces. Discuss your volume requirements with your supplier to find a cost-effective solution.
